The QA Specialist helps ensure the overall quality of the Zoomph platform. The role writes and executes test plans and test cases, performs manual and automated functional, regression, and integration testing across releases, and identifies, documents, and tracks defects to resolution. Working closely with engineering and product, the role catches issues before they reach customers and helps keep the product stable and reliable. This is a strong fit for a detail-oriented QA professional who wants to help raise product quality in a fast-paced SaaS environment.
